News Kristin Chenoweth Will Play a Pill-Popping Assistant in New Comedy Film Tony winner Kristin Chenoweth and Uma Thurman will star in "The Brits Are Coming," a comedy about an eccentric British couple who flee to Los Angeles and plot a jewel theft, according to the Hollywood Reporter.

The project — produced by Cassian Elwes, filmmaker J.C. Chandor, Robert Ogden Barnum and Will Clevinger — will be directed by James Oakley, who co-wrote the film with Alex Michaelides. Shooting is scheduled to begin in July, when Chenoweth's Broadway show On the Twentieth Century (for which she received a Tony nomination for) will conclude its run.

The movie will follow Harriet (Thurman) and Peter Fox, who travel to L.A. to avoid paying a large debt after a failed poker game. The two plan a jewel theft operation involving Peter's ex-wife and her new husband, Gabriel. Chenoweth will play Gabriel's pill-popping assistant, Gina.
